红花国槐嫁接繁殖技术研究
Study on Techniques Grafting Propagation in Red-Flower Sophora japonica
摘要:
国槐是重要的园林绿化树种,全国各地每年需要大量的国槐苗木。国槐苗木培育方法很多,其中嫁接育苗成活率高、生长快、苗木质量好,易培养出健康的国槐大苗。本文研究了红花国槐多种嫁接繁殖技术,得出接穗粗度为1.0 cm~1.5 cm,砧木在3 cm粗以下时采用劈接成活率最高,当砧木粗度在3 cm以上时,采用切接和插皮接两种技术嫁接成活率高,且嫁接速度快、伤口愈合快、操作简单、易掌握。
Abstract:
Sophora japonica is an important tree species for landscaping. A large number of Sophora japonica seedlings are needed every year all over the country. There are many ways to cultivate Sophora japonica seedlings. The survival rate is high, the growth is fast, the seedling quality is good and it is easy to cultivate healthy and big seedlings by grafting and seedling-raising techniques. This paper had studied several grafting propagation techniques in red-flower Sophora japonica. The result of the study is drawing the following conclusion: When scion diameter is 1.0 cm - 1.5 cm and stock diameter is less than 3 cm, the highest survival rate of cleft grafting. However, the stock diameter is than 3 cm, the higher survival rate both of tangent grafting and skin insertion grafting, and it is simple to operate, easy to know well, fast to graft and fast to grow together.
